- W2023158162 abstract "Abstract Background and Aim: Helicobacter pylori is a major cause of chronic gastritis and peptic ulcer disease and a definite carcinogen for gastric adenocarcinoma. However, the underlying pathogenic mechanisms are not fully understood. Interleukin‐1 (IL‐1) is a key cytokine involved in H. pylori ‐induced gastric inflammation. The present study aimed to determine polymorphisms of IL‐1B and IL‐1 receptor antagonist ( IL‐1RN ) genes and their association with H. pylori infection and gastroduodenal diseases in Chinese patients. Methods: Three hundred and ninety‐nine patients with gastroduodenal diseases (129 chronic gastritis, 127 duodenal ulcer and 143 non‐cardiac gastric cancer) and 264 healthy controls were genotyped for IL‐1B‐ 511 and IL‐1RN gene polymorphisms by the PCR‐RFLP method. H. pylori infection status was determined by a validated serological test. Results: The frequency of IL‐1B‐ 511 T allele was significantly higher in H. pylori positive patients with non‐cardiac gastric cancer than in both H. pylori negative patients with non‐cardiac gastric cancer (60% vs 46%, P = 0.0342, OR = 1.666, 95% confidence interval [CI]: 1.045–2.656) and in healthy controls (60% vs 48%, P = 0.0071, OR = 1.665, 95%CI: 1.149–2.412). However, the polymorphism was not associated with chronic gastritis and duodenal ulcer. Multivariate logistic regression analyses identified that IL‐1B‐ 511 T/T carrier status was an independent risk factor for non‐cardiac gastric cancer in the presence of H. pylori infection (adjusted OR = 3.01, 95%CI: 1.27–7.11, P = 0.01), and the frequency of IL‐1B‐ 511 T allele was an increased risk factor for developing gastric cancer ( P = 0.03, adjusted OR = 2.29, 95%CI: 1.08–4.86). There was no association between IL‐1RN gene polymorphisms and H. pylori infection and other gastroduodenal diseases. Conclusion: IL‐1B‐ 511 T allele is associated with H. pylori infection in non‐cardiac gastric cancer in a Chinese population. The IL‐1B‐ 511 gene polymorphism appears to play an important role in gastric carcinogenesis in Chinese patients with H. pylori infection." @default.
